Structural Analysis Software: Boosts the Productivity of Structural Engineers

Nonlinear Structural Analysis has become extremely important in civil engineering to study the behavior of structures when subject to hazardous loads such as those generated by a blast, seismic events, impact, progressive collapse, and the wind. And to study the behaviour, you can use structural analysis software. These are valuable tools that offer greater flexibility to the engineers, make it easy for them to calculate the maximum load, and eliminate construction errors.
 
Even, many software tools are programmed with building codes for every geographic area so that it will be easier for engineers to optimize the project, eliminate revisions, and stay on schedule and within budget. Let’s discuss four common applications of Structural Engineering Software. Have a look-
 
  • Glass Performance Analysis
Structural Analysis Software allows users to perform advanced structural vulnerability assessments to better understand the performance of a structure’s glazing.  
 
  • Corrosion Analysis
Now, structural engineers can consider the effects of corrosion over time using the powerful features of Structural Analysis Software. These tools automatically calculate crack initiation, propagation, and separation of elements.
 
  • Wind Analysis
Structure analysis software allows engineers to study the behaviour of structure when subject to extreme wind loads. Using such software, users are able to identify whether the structure will collapse due to an extreme wind event, the severity of collapse, collapse mode, the effect on surrounding structures, and more.
 
  • Impact Analysis
Using these software tools, users can analyze the impact of moving objects and their effect on the structure. They can even assess the velocity and dispersion of debris and glass fragmentation.
